Transaction efc2b84260c1e043456280d255dbaa7e280cd288ee025ba4f913e0a1bcc2d2df
1 Input
1 Output
-
efc2b84260c1e043456280d255dbaa7e280cd288ee025ba4f913e0a1bcc2d2df:0
- value
- 26887
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4e299c00d62298702be540daf7a55cf4aa82ce3 OP_EQUAL
- address
- 3Q1rFqPjmeqpdS5S1KHoE1kH8cVF2FWgxv